Can I Embed a Visualforce "page" on a standard layout?

I think the answer is "No" but I wanted to make sure before I explored other options. I want to embed a VF "page" on a standard layout in the same way that I used to embed S-Controls on a standard layout.

 

TIA,

 

John

Best Answer chosen by Admin (Salesforce Developers) 
XXXXXX
Never mind, you have to set the page's controller as a standard controller and then it shows up on the page layout editor.
